Soybean, soy bean, or soya bean, is an annual leguminous plant that is widely grown and consumed because of the numerous nutritional composition and health benefits of the edible seed. Holy basil (Ocimum sanctum, or Ocimum tenuiflorum) or Tulsi, Tulasi, “Queen of herbs”, “Mother Medicine of Nature” is a plant belonging to the family, Lamiaceae. Basil (Ocimum basilicum L.), or great basil or Saint-Joseph’s-wort, is a plant belonging to the mint family, Lamiaceae. The genus, Ocimum, has 50 to 150 species of plants. Dandelion (Taraxacum officinale L. syn. Taraxacum vulgaris L.) is an edible plant belonging to the family, Asteraceae. Dandelion is derived from the French word, dent de leon, meaning “lion’s tooth”. Beetroot or beets (Beta Vulgaris) is the edible taproot part of a beet plant. It is a herbaceous vegetable that is widely consumed because of its high nutritional composition. Aquagenic pruritus is a dermatological disorder that cause harsh pricking-like feeling/itch. The itching is triggered by the presence of water of any kind (including rainwater, seawater, bath/tap water, and even swimming pool water) on the skin. The water could be hot, cold, or tepid. Bay leaf, known as Laurus nobilis, sweet bay, laurel leaf, leaf of the sweet bay tree, is a popular perennial herb used in numerous cuisines around the world for its distinctive flavor and aroma. Uterine fibroids, also called leiomyomas, are a benign tumor common in women of reproductive age. Though the tumor is not cancerous and rarely symptomatic, it may cause severe symptoms such as anemia, uterine bleeding, pelvic pain and pressure, back pain, constipation, or infertility, in some women.
